Can you control stepper motor with Arduino?

The stepper is controlled by with digital pins 8, 9, 10, and 11 for either unipolar or bipolar motors. The Arduino board will connect to a U2004 Darlington Array if you’re using a unipolar stepper or a SN754410NE H-Bridge if you have a bipolar motor.

Are stepper motors good generators?

Any stepper motor can be used as a generator. In contrast to other generators, a stepper motor produces a large induced voltage even at low rotational speeds. The type used here, with a DC resistance of 2×60 Ω per winding, can generate more than 20 V when turned by hand, without any gearing.

Can a stepper motor generate power?

Remember stepper motors generate power at low RPMs, which makes generating power an option. At just a few hundred RPMs usable power can be produced. Like wind turbines and other low RPM power sources this means the stepper motor can be driven directly from the source without having to use gearing.

Are stepper motors good for wheels?

The characteristics of stepper motors that appealed to me were their ability to precisely turn a wheel at a calculated distance and their ability to brake. Stepper motors are not a panacea for robot propulsion. They are heavier, use more power, and have far less torque than traditional DC motors.

Can stepper motors run on AC?

Drives for stepper motors can have inputs that are either ac or dc. What happens inside the drive is that the input signal is converted to a series of square wave pulses that are applied to the motor’s windings to power the motor and produce motion.

How can we control the speed of a stepper motor?

Speed of stepper motors are controlled by input pulses They use open-loop control, and are operated by having a controller generate pulses that are input to a driver, which in turn supplies the drive current to the motor.

Does NEMA 17 have encoder?

This nema 17 closed loop stepper motor with 43.5mm thickness include encoder. The encoder is a magnetic encoder with 3 channels and 1000PPR(4000CPR) resolution. The biggest advantage for magnetic encoder is the size and cost, they are widely used in small space and higher cost performance.

Which is better servo or stepper motor?

The main benefit of servo motors is they provide high levels of torque at high speed – something stepper motors can’t do. They also operate at 80 – 90% efficiency. Servo motors can work in AC or DC drive, and do not suffer from vibration or resonance issues.

Can you turn a stepper motor by hand?

Normally, you can easily turn a stepper motor shaft by hand, and you can feel each of the 200 ‘detents’ as you rotate the shaft.

How many leads do stepper motors have?

Unipolar stepper motors typically have five, six, or eight leads. Bipolar steppers have a single coil per phase and require more complicated control circuitry (typically an H-bridge for each phase).

Do all stepper motors need drivers?

Stepper motors require a driver. There are usually 200 steps per revolution or 1.8 degrees per step (but they also can be “micro-stepped”). In general, you use an H-driver to reverse a DC motor, but it can also be done with a DPDT relay.

Is a BLDC motor a stepper motor?

BLDC motors are optimized for smooth torque between steps, not repeatability. Stepper motors are designed to maximize holding torque, the stepper’s ability to hold the mechanical load at one of the steps. This is accomplished by keeping the winding current high even though the rotor is aligned with the stator.

How much torque can a stepper motor generate?

For example, a conventional size 34 stepper motor can produce 5.9 N-m of holding torque. The ultra-high-torque version of the same motor produces up to 9 N-m of holding torque. For a conventional motor to achieve this same torque rating would require a 31% longer motor.
